宝塔面板修改默认的放行端口8888为8001并且生效

要想使用宝塔面板,必须去centos7.6安全组策略配置8888的端口,宝塔面板默认端口是8888,但是为了服务器的安全,我们一般会后面修改8888端口。以腾讯云轻量应用服务器为例。

1、首先去腾讯云的防火墙里面配置一个端口,比如说8001,并放行

2、我们使用xshell命令行输入 netstat -lntup 查看所有的端口情况,

3、登陆宝塔最早的那个生成的登陆地址(类似 http://46.192.213.89:8888/a5f764fd),输入账号密码,进入宝塔管理服务器页面,找到面板设置,修改面板端口(8888)为 8001,并保存。

<think>好的,用户提到修改默认端口后无法访问面板了。首先,我需要确定用户具体修改的是哪个服务的端口,以及他们所说的“面板”指的是什么。常见的面板宝塔面板、cPanel、Plesk等,这里可能是指宝塔面板,因为在国内使用较多。 用户可能按照之前的指导修改了SSH端口,或者修改面板本身的端口。如果是面板端口修改,那么需要检查防火墙和安全组是否放行了新端口。比如,宝塔面板默认使用8888端口,如果用户修改为8889,但没有在安全组中放行,就会导致无法访问。 接下来要考虑的是,用户是否正确修改面板的配置文件,并重启了相关服务。例如,宝塔面板需要修改/www/server/panel/data/port.pl文件,并执行bt restart重启服务。如果用户只是修改了配置文件但没有重启,或者配置文件路径错误,也会导致端口生效。 另外,服务器本地的防火墙(如iptables或firewalld)可能没有允许新端口,需要检查并添加规则。同时,云服务提供商的安全组设置是否更新,比如阿里云、腾讯云的安全组规则需要手动调整。 还要考虑是否有其他服务占用了新端口,导致冲突。用户可以使用netstat或lsof命令检查端口占用情况。 可能用户没有意识到修改端口后访问地址需要加上新端口号,例如http://IP:新端口。或者浏览器缓存导致没有正确跳转,可以尝试清除缓存或使用无痕模式访问。 如果用户同时修改了SSH端口面板端口,可能需要分别检查两者的配置是否正确,以及相应的防火墙和安全组设置是否都更新了。特别是如果用户远程连接服务器时使用的是SSH,而面板使用另一个端口,两者都需要正确配置。 最后,如果所有配置都正确,但问题依旧,可能需要查看面板的日志文件,如宝塔的日志在/www/wwwlogs/目录下,检查是否有错误信息。或者尝试将端口改回默认值,确认是否是端口修改导致的问题,以排除其他可能性。</think>以下是修改服务器面板默认端口后无法访问的排查指南(所有行内代码需用$...$包裹): --- ### 一、基础验证(耗时约3分钟) 1. **访问地址格式**: - 正确格式:$http://服务器IP:新端口$ - 错误示例:继续使用旧端口访问(常见于浏览器缓存) 2. **本地端口测试**: ```bash telnet 服务器IP 新端口 ``` - 成功:显示$Connected$ - 失败:显示$Connection\ refused$ --- ### 二、面板服务验证(核心排查) 1. **服务状态检查**: ```bash # 宝塔面板 /etc/init.d/bt status # cPanel systemctl status cpsrv ``` - 正常状态应包含$running$ 2. **配置文件验证**: ```bash # 宝塔端口文件 cat /www/server/panel/data/port.pl # 其他面板查看对应配置文件 ``` - 确认实际端口修改值一致 --- ### 三、防火墙四重检查(关键步骤) | 检查层级 | 命令示例 | 解决方案 | |----------|----------|----------| | 服务器本地防火墙 | `iptables -L -n \| grep 新端口` | 添加规则:$iptables -A INPUT -p tcp --dport 新端口 -j ACCEPT$ | | 云平台安全组 | 通过控制台检查入站规则 | 在安全组中添加TCP/新端口规则 | | 面板自带防火墙 | (宝塔面板安全 > 放行端口 | 在面板后台添加新端口 | | SELinux状态 | `semanage port -l \| grep 新端口` | 添加SELinux规则:$semanage port -a -t http_port_t -p tcp 新端口$ | --- ### 四、端口冲突检测 ```bash netstat -tulnp | grep 新端口 ``` - 显示$LISTEN$状态表示正常 - 若显示其他进程占用: ```bash kill -9 进程PID # 强制终止冲突进程 或修改面板为其他端口 ``` --- ### 五、特殊场景处理 1. **Nginx/Apache反向代理失效**: ```bash # 检查代理配置 grep 新端口 /www/server/panel/vhost/nginx/*.conf ``` - 需要同步修改代理配置中的端口 2. **HTTPS证书问题**: - 若使用HTTPS且修改443端口: ```bash # 检查证书绑定 cat /www/server/panel/ssl/domain.crt ``` - 需要重新申请证书或配置SNI --- ### 六、快速恢复方案 ```bash # 宝塔面板恢复默认端口8888) echo "8888" > /www/server/panel/data/port.pl && /etc/init.d/bt restart ``` **注意**:执行后需立即检查安全组是否开放8888端口 --- ### 七、日志分析 | 日志类型 | 路径 | 关键字段 | |----------|------|----------| | 访问日志 | `/www/wwwlogs/面板访问日志` | $CONNECTION\ REFUSED$ | | 错误日志 | `/var/log/messages` | $Address\ already\ in\ use$ | | 面板日志 | `/www/server/panel/logs/error.log` | $Listen\ failed$ | --- 建议按照$服务状态→防火墙→端口冲突→代理配置$的顺序排查,85%的端口修改问题源于防火墙未同步更新。若使用云服务器,安全组配置更新后通常需要2-5分钟生效。若仍无法解决,可提供以下信息: 1. `iptables -L -n`输出 2. 云平台安全组截图 3. `netstat -tulnp | grep 新端口`结果
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

尔嵘

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值